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 ½ cups sugar
  • 1 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 3 large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ons cocoa powder
  • 1 ½ te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1 tablespoon red food coloring
  • 8 oz cream cheese
  • ½ cup unsalted butter
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

Instructions

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

First things first, set your oven to 350°F (175°C). Preheating your oven ensures that your cake starts baking at the right temperature, creating that perfectly soft crumb. It’s akin to warming up before a race; your cake wants to have a solid start!

Step 2: Prepare Your Cake Pans

Grab your two 9-inch round cake pans and grease them generously with butter or non-stick spray. After greasing, dust them with a little flour to prevent any sticky situations later. This way, your cakes will slide right out, waiting for their lovely layer of frosting.

Step 3: Mix the Dry Ingredients

In a mixing b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t. This blend is essential for achieving that classic red velvet flavor with the perfect slight richness. Allow the aromas to stimulate your senses—cocoa always brings a delightful warmth!

Step 4: Blend the Wet Ingredients

In another bowl, beat together sugar, vegetable oil, and eggs. Add in buttermilk, red food coloring, and vanilla extract. This vibrant mixture is what gives red velvet its signature hue and moisture. Enjoy the transformation as the bright red color melds with the other ingredients.

Step 5: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ures

G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ture. Stir slowly, ensuring everything is combined without over-mixing; this helps maintain that tender crumb you crave. Splashing batter around can make a mess, so keep it steady and focus on the happy task at hand.

Step 6: Pour the Batter into the Pans

Divide the luscious batter evenly between your prepared cake pans. No need for complicated tricks here; just scoop and spread it evenly. Each pan should have about the same amount to ensure uniform layers—let visual balance guide your hand!

Step 7: Bake Your Cake

Pop those pans into the preheated oven and let them bake for about 25-30 minutes. You’ll know they’re ready when a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Use this time to enjoy the comforting aroma wafting through your kitchen!

Step 8: Cool the Cakes

Once baked, take the cakes out and set them aside to cool in the pans for 10 minutes. After that, gently turn them out onto wire racks to cool completely. Cooking time is about control, so let the cakes relax; the cooling process helps finalize their structure.

Step 9: Frost Your Cake

Whip up a rich cream cheese frosting by beating softened cream cheese and butter, then mix in powdered sugar and a splash of vanilla. Spread this delightful frosting generously between your cooled cake layers and on top. The thick frosting adds a creamy contrast to your velvety layers.

Step 10: Decorate

For a show-stopping finish, add decorative elements like sprinkles, chocolate shavings, or fresh berries on top. These touches elevate your red velvet cake from simple to stunning, adding a personal flair. Your cake is now ready to impress with its festive appearance!

Notes

Note 1: Using Room Temperature Ingredients

Ensure your eggs, buttermilk, and butter are at room temperature before mixing. This step creates a smoother batter, which results in a more delightful texture. It’s time to say goodbye to cold!

Note 2: Choosing the Right Cocoa Powder

For authentic flavor, use high-quality cocoa powder. The robustness of flavor significantly impacts the end result of your cake, making it richer and more decadent.
